HTCA
Heat Transfer Compound - Aerosol
HTCA offers a way of applying a thin, even film of HTC and is especially useful for applications over larger
areas. HTCA is recommended where the efficient and reliable thermal coupling of electronic components or
heat dissipation between any surfaces are required. HTCA is a non-silicone paste, suitable for applications
where silicones are prohibited, thus avoiding issues with silicone and low molecular weight siloxane migration.
Aerosol product; ideal for application over larger areas
Based on a non-silicone oil; avoids issues with silicone and LMW siloxane migration
Good thermal conductivity; designed for use as a thermal interface material
Non-curing paste; allows simple and efficient rework of components if required

Typical Properties Colour: White
Base: Blend of synthetic fluids
Thermo-conductive Component: Powdered metal oxides
Thermal Conductivity (Guarded Hot Plate): 0.9 W/mK
Thermal Conductivity (Heat Flow): 0.7 W/mK (calculated)
Density @ 20°C (g/ml): 2.04
Temperature Range: -50°C to +130°C
Weight Loss after 96 hours @ 100°C: <1.0%
Permittivity @ 106Hz: 4.2
Volume Resistivity: 1 x 10
14
Ohms-cm
Dielectric Strength: 42 kV/mm
Cone Penetration @ 20°C: 300
